I only know of sync systems between device and PC (or device and Exchange
Server).
To sync between 2 devices, you may need to install Outlook on your home
computer, along with AS 4.1. Then sync iPaq to home PC, then sync SPV to
home PC.

By the way: I believe that you should be able to sync either device direct
with the Exchange Server, if that has been configured for you.
